Release of Collateral or Guarantors. Each Lender hereby consents to the release and hereby directs Administrative Agent to release (or, in the case of clause (b)(ii) below, release or subordinate), and the Administrative Agent shall release (or, in the case of clause (b)(ii) below, release or subordinate) the following: (a) any Subsidiary of the Borrower (and, in the case of (iv), each Guarantor) from its guaranty of any Obligation (i) if all or substantially all of the Capital Stock of such Subsidiary owned by any Loan Party are sold or transferred in a transaction permitted under the Loan Documents (including pursuant to a waiver or consent), (ii) if all or substantially all the property of such Subsidiary owned by any Loan Party are sold or transferred in a transaction permitted under the Loan Documents (including pursuant to a waiver or consent) and such Subsidiary is concurrently wound up or otherwise no longer required to be a Guarantor hereunder, (iii) if the Borrower, at its option, otherwise causes any Excluded Subsidiary to become a Guarantor and subsequently wants such Subsidiary to be released from its guaranty; provided, that the designation of any such Loan Party as an Excluded Subsidiary (other than for the purpose of avoiding any adverse tax consequences to the Borrower and its Subsidiaries as a result of any changes following the time such Excluded Subsidiary initially became a Guarantor) shall constitute an Investment by the Borrower therein at the date of designation in an amount equal to the fair market value of the net assets of such Loan Party (and such designation shall only be permitted to the extent such Investment is permitted under Section 7.7) and the Borrower shall have delivered a certificate of a Responsible Officer to the Administrative Agent certifying that such Subsidiary has become an Excluded Subsidiary and, with respect to any Loan Party, that such designation is permitted hereunder and entered into for a bona fide business purpose (as determined by the Borrower in good faith) and (iv) upon the Discharge of Obligations; and (b) any Lien held by Administrative Agent for the benefit of the Secured Parties against (i) any Collateral that is sold, transferred, conveyed or otherwise disposed of by a Loan Party to a Person other than a Loan Party in a transaction permitted by the Loan Documents (including pursuant to a valid waiver or consent), (ii) any Property subject to a Lien permitted hereunder in reliance upon Section 7.3(h) and/or Section 7.3(l) (to the extent the relevant Lien is of the type described in Section 7.3(h)), (iii) all of the Collateral and all Loan Parties, upon (A) the Discharge of Obligations and (B) to the extent requested by Administrative Agent, receipt by Administrative Agent and the Secured Parties of liability releases from the Loan Parties each in form and substance reasonably acceptable to Administrative Agent, (iv) any Property ceases to constitute Collateral in accordance with the terms of the Loan Documents and the Loan Parties shall have delivered a certificate of a Responsible Officer to the Administrative Agent certifying that such Property is no longer Collateral and/or (v) if such Property is owned by a Loan Party, upon the release of such Loan Party from its Guaranty in accordance with Section 9.10(a). Each Lender hereby directs Administrative Agent, and Administrative Agent hxxxxx agrees, upon receipt of reasonable advance notice from the Borrower, to execute and deliver or file such documents and to perform other actions reasonably necessary at the Borrower’s expense to release the guaranties and Lxxxx when and as directed in this Section 9.10.
